I was born in Salem, Oregon, and moved to California when I was 9 months old. I grew up in a rural small town in Northern California, moved away when I graduated high school, but have since been back to raise my family and settle down.

I’m married with three children. We enjoy camping, boating, Jeeping, being outside, and that good old comfortable feeling of just being home and spending time together. My husband and I are very involved with our community and various local organizations, always lending a hand where needed with Gold Country Girls softball, Rotary, Friends of Golden Sierra, and Divide Recreation Association. I am also a trustee on our local school board to further make a difference in the community.

We live on a small farm with many animals! We have dogs, cats, cows, chickens, ducks, horses, and goats. Most of my immediate family lives in the same community, so we can get together often.

I have been licensed for over 17 years and love working with clients as I strive to figure out the best loan program to suit their needs. I love what I do, love where I live, and feel very fortunate to be where I am.
